Woman arrested after teenager stabbed in Kamloops park

A woman was arrested after a teenager was found with a stab wound in a Kamloops park earlier this week.

Kamloops RCMP were called to McArthur Island Park about an assault with a weapon around 10:20 p.m. Wednesday, March 5 and officers found an intoxicated teenager with a non-life-threatening stab wound, according to a press release from police.

The teenager was taken to hospital in an ambulance.

“While police were tending to the victim, another officer located a suspect in her 20s and arrested her,” Kamloops RCMP media liaison officer Cpl. Crystal Evelyn said in the release. “She was held in cells until sober, then released with a court date and conditions.”

RCMP said charge recommendations are expected.
